Output 70b69339c7942e05a7575858a7ea0584a240226c34e39efae400a87f4e8f7d96:0

value
2709109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a85709a3a641653c7ec67f6fa6aeda904f019d12 OP_EQUAL
address
3H37iFepTKByuqi6wbZxWe3YLPTi9iSJgJ
transaction
70b69339c7942e05a7575858a7ea0584a240226c34e39efae400a87f4e8f7d96
spent
true